"Military globalization" refers to

a. networks of interdependence in which force, or the threat of force, is employed.
b. the spread of weapons technology and armaments throughout the world.
c. the interdependent instability that results from small conflicts spreading into neighboring states.
d. the increase in military budgets resulting from a growing lack of security in the world.
e. the increasing role of violent transnational groups such as terrorist organizations.


Answer: a
